Ladder Capital Historical Dividend Yield Growth

A solid dividend growth pattern of Ladder Capital could indicate future dividend growth is likely, which can signal long-term profitability for Ladder Capital Corp. When investors calculate the dividend yield growth rate, they can use any interval of time they wish. They may also calculate the dividend yield growth rate using the least-squares method or simply take an annualized figure over a given time period.
Dividend Yield is Ladder Capital Corp dividend as a percentage of Ladder Capital stock price. Ladder Capital Corp dividend yield is a measure of Ladder Capital stock productivity, which can be interpreted as interest rate earned on an Ladder Capital investment. A financial ratio that shows how much a company pays out in dividends each year relative to its stock price, calculated as annual dividends per share divided by price per share.

The market value of Ladder Capital Corp is measured differently than its book value, which is the value of Ladder that is recorded on the company's balance sheet. Investors also form their own opinion of Ladder Capital's value that differs from its market value or its book value, called intrinsic value, which is Ladder Capital's true underlying value. Investors use various methods to calculate intrinsic value and buy a stock when its market value falls below its intrinsic value. Because Ladder Capital's market value can be influenced by many factors that don't directly affect Ladder Capital's underlying business (such as a pandemic or basic market pessimism), market value can vary widely from intrinsic value.
Please note, there is a significant difference between Ladder Capital's value and its price as these two are different measures arrived at by different means. Investors typically determine if Ladder Capital is a good investment by looking at such factors as earnings, sales, fundamental and technical indicators, competition as well as analyst projections. However, Ladder Capital's price is the amount at which it trades on the open market and represents the number that a seller and buyer find agreeable to each party.
